Future Watch: Robert Puason Rookie Baseball Cards, A’s –  Robert Puason was signed by the Oakland A’s as an international free agent in the summer of 2019, as a 16-year-old shortstop. He is known as the top shortstop prospect out of the Dominican Republic.

At 6-3, 185, you hear that five-tool player tag when analysts talk about this prospect. His defense is currently ahead of his offense and that’s something that’s normal and when his offense kicks in, watch out.

According to his MLB.com Prospect Profile:

Overall, Puason is a fast-twitch athlete that makes solid contact from both sides of the plate. He has shown a polished approach with fluid swings and the ability to sprays line drives to all fields. He has good barrel control and extension for his age. Like most prospects his age, he continues to work on his hitting mechanics, and it’s the development of the hit tool that could make him an everyday player in the big leagues one day. For now, he uses a semi-open stance and semi-uppercut swing from both sides of the plate and projects to have average power.

He’s already an above average runner.  On defense, he shows fluid actions and good footwork. He has an above-average throwing arm now with solid carry and it’s expected to get better as he develops. Add good hands along with great instincts, and it makes for an above-average package that could keep Puason at shortstop for the rest of his career. ETA TDB

As a top prospect, Robert Pauson already has literally hundreds of baseball cards on the market. His earliest cards can be found in 2017 Panini Elite Extra Edition. Collectors can find his first Bowman cards in 2020 Bowman with autographs.
